Latest Patents

Timmons holds a patent for a unique steel-making flux. The patent describes the use of phosphorus furnace slag as a ladle flux and/or tundish flux in the continuous casting of steel. This innovative material combines essential properties such as thermal insulation, oxidation protection, and inclusion absorption, making it highly effective for its intended purpose.
